A quick overview on Revolut and Western Union

What is Revolut?

Revolut is a digital banking platform that integrates various financial services into a single mobile application. It offers users the ability to perform peer-to-peer payments, manage multi-currency accounts, and execute international transfers at competitive exchange rates. Additionally, Revolut provides virtual and physical debit cards, enabling users to make online and in-store purchases globally.

Revolut's unique features include real-time spending notifications, built-in budgeting tools, and the ability to hold and exchange multiple currencies seamlessly. Common use cases include facilitating travel expenses, managing freelance payments, and supporting business operations with expense management and international transactions.

What is Western Union?

Western Union is a comprehensive money transfer service that facilitates both domestic and international transactions. It supports various currencies and payout methods, including cash pickups, bank deposits, and mobile wallets.

Unique benefits include an extensive global reach, enabling customers to send and receive money in numerous countries, and multiple transfer options such as online, mobile app, and in-person services. Common use cases include personal remittances, business payments, and emergency transfers.

Pricing of Revolut and Western Union

Revolut offers a tiered pricing structure with plans ranging from free to $16.99 per month. The Standard plan is free, providing essential features, while the Premium and Metal plans offer additional benefits like higher withdrawal limits and cashback. Users should be aware of potential fees for specific services, such as currency exchanges on weekends or transactions exceeding plan limits.

Western Union's pricing varies based on factors like destination, transfer amount, and payment method. For instance, sending $500 to Mexico may incur a fee of $2, while a similar transfer to the UK could cost around $12. Fees and exchange rates can fluctuate, making it essential to check current rates before initiating a transfer.

Revolut generally offers more cost-effective pricing compared to Western Union, especially for frequent users and larger transactions.

Features of Revolut and Western Union

Revolut features

Revolut offers a range of unique features that cater to both individual and business users, making it a versatile financial platform:

  • Real-Time Spending Notifications: Users receive instant alerts for every transaction, helping them stay on top of their finances.
  • Built-In Budgeting Tools: The app includes features to set budgets, track spending, and manage financial goals effortlessly.
  • Competitive Currency Exchange Rates: Revolut provides favorable exchange rates for international transactions, saving users money on currency conversions.
  • Multi-Currency Accounts: Users can hold and exchange multiple currencies within a single account, making it ideal for frequent travelers and international business operations.
  • Cryptocurrency Trading: Unlike many traditional banks, Revolut allows users to buy, sell, and hold cryptocurrencies directly within the app, offering a modern investment option.

Western Union features

Western Union offers a range of unique features that cater to both individual and business users, making it a versatile financial platform:

  • Extensive Global Reach: Enables customers to send and receive money in numerous countries, even in remote areas.
  • Multiple Transfer Options: Offers online transfers, a user-friendly mobile app, and in-person services at agent locations.
  • Rapid Transactions: Provides options for quick transfers, with funds often available within minutes.
  • Diverse Payment Methods: Accepts various payment methods, including bank accounts, credit/debit cards, and cash.
  • Real-Time Tracking: Allows users to monitor their transfers in real-time, ensuring transparency and peace of mind.

Why choose one over the other?

  • Why Use Revolut Over Western Union: Revolut offers a more comprehensive financial platform with features like real-time spending notifications, built-in budgeting tools, and competitive currency exchange rates. For frequent travelers and businesses, Revolut's multi-currency accounts and lower fees for international transfers provide significant cost savings and convenience compared to Western Union.
  • Why Use Western Union Over Revolut: Western Union excels in its extensive global reach and rapid transaction capabilities, making it ideal for urgent money transfers and remittances. With a vast network of agent locations and multiple transfer options, Western Union provides a reliable solution for individuals needing to send or receive money in remote areas where digital banking services like Revolut may not be as accessible.

Revolut reviews

Customer reviews of Revolut highlight several recurring issues. Users frequently mention challenges with customer support, including difficulties in reaching representatives and delays in resolving issues. Additionally, there are reports of account freezes or closures without clear communication, causing frustration among customers. Check out more Revolut reviews here.

Western Union reviews

Customer reviews of Western Union highlight several recurring issues. Users frequently mention high fees and less favorable exchange rates, which can impact the total amount received by the recipient. Additionally, there are reports of challenges with customer service responsiveness and technical issues with the online platform and mobile app. Check out more Western Union reviews here.
